Job Description

Overview:

Are you seeking an opportunity to work with todays most advanced thin film processing tools Anelva tools have been delivering cutting edge performance in thin films deposition (PVD) and enabling our customers to manufacture the most advanced hard disks and volatile memories/nonvolatile memories. We have an exciting opportunity in San Jose CA to directly interface with customers to support their Anelva equipment in the field which includes troubleshooting and installations.

This position performs technical support of the high vacuum equipment for PVD and related robotics. The individual must understand vacuum technology general practices and procedures within the semiconductor field and be able to apply such skills fluently to perform field service duties at customers clean room. In addition provide oncall technical support which may require off shift work.

This position requires fulltime presence at your assigned office(s)/worksite(s).

Responsibilities:

Please Note: This is a customerfacing role and requires compliance with customer policies and protocols which may include COVID19 vaccination and other measures relating to COVID19

  • Responsible to monitor inspect setup calibrate and maintain semiconductor process equipment in the field to prevent equipment down time.
  • Troubleshoot hardware and software related issues and implement solutions
  • Collect data for software related issues and discuss with headquarter in Japan.
  • Accurately document all maintenance activity and provide field service reports.
  • Install equipment control software and maintain record of software revision history.
  • Participate in the installation of equipment at customers sites.
  • Monitor stock level of service parts and equipment to ensure adequate inventory is available for repair work.
  • Provide training and assistance to other technicians.
  • Effectively communicate with customers Canon USA and CanonAnelva Japan employees
  • Escalate serious or complicated repair problems to senior level team members.
